In cricket, hosts England were 353/7 till the lunch break. England resumed their first innings at the overnight score of 251/4 against India on Day 2 of the third Test of the Anderson-Tendulkar Trophy at Lord’s. England ended Day One yesterday in a strong position, with Joe Root unbeaten on 99 runs and Ben Stokes on 39 at the crease at stumps.
